## Approvals: Websocket Reconnect Fix

This page tracks sign-off for the patch addressing the reconnect storm in the Pondbridge gateway, where dropped websocket sessions retried without backoff and overwhelmed the edge nodes. The fix adds jittered exponential backoff and caps concurrent reconnect attempts per client. QA has verified behavior under simulated network flaps, and load testing passed on staging. Before we schedule the rollout, we need one final approval per our change policy. The approver responsible for this change is named below.

account owner for tawip-kahop: Oliok Jorix Ulaath Quenok

Image-slimming pipeline recovery (Dorvane registry). If the slimmer account is locked out after repeated pushes, first confirm the lockout in the audit log, then pause the build queue before touching credentials. Never delete the account. To restore access through the recovery console, carefully enter the passphrase below.

unlock words, yawig-kagef: gordor-holvan-ulaael-pramir-ulaiel-tamdor

## Ticket: Intermittent connection failures on transcode workers

Since Tuesday, workers in the Fernhollow transcoding farm have been dropping their database connections mid-job, leaving rows stuck in `claimed` state. Suspected cause is the pooler restart loop on the vidops cluster. As a first step, reproduce by running a single worker against the affected database and watching for resets in the logs. Requeue any stuck jobs afterward with the `unclaim` script. Use the following connection string to reach the affected instance.

primary connection of yagep-kahip = redis://giliel_svc:zYiKsLL2PLpfPL@db-348f.xolmarsys.corp:5432/fenwyn

Subject: Scanner cut-over complete — welcome reading

Hi all — for new folks: last weekend we cut the warehouse floor over from the legacy Pindrop scanners to the new Quillscan barcode integration. Scans now post directly to the inventory service instead of batching hourly, and mis-read retries are handled device-side. Everything has been stable since Monday. The integration currently runs with the following configuration.

deployment values, yadug-bawif:
[framir]
team = pelox
access_code = ac_a38ab2
owner = tamion.julael
host = framir.tolvaqlabs.test
port = 11211
peer = tammir.zemvargrid.local
salt = 2215ef03
pin = 1541